> Recently, we wanted to introduce TubeMQ into Kylin, but we found that TubeMQ could not meet the usage scenarios of Kylin. Therefore, we hope that TubeMQ provides the following functions:
> 1. Support to get the maximum offset of every partitions
> 2. consume a specify partition
> 3. Support consumpe data in the specified offset interval
